We present a calculation of the lowest excited states of the Heisenberg
ferromagnet in 1-d for any wave vector. These turn out to be string solutions
of Bethe's equations with a macroscopic number of particles in them. These are
identified as generalized quantum Bloch wall states, and a simple physical
picture provided for the same.
